How much do hourly rn medical device sales jobs pay per week?

As of Sep 5, 2026, the average weekly pay for hourly rn medical device sales in Milwaukee, WI is $2,046.04,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$1,686.54 and $2,340.38 per week,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an hourly RN medical device sales job?

Hourly RN Medical Device Sales jobs involve registered nurses (RNs) working on an hourly basis to promote, educate, and sometimes sell medical devices to healthcare providers and facilities. These roles leverage the RN's clinical expertise to demonstrate product benefits, train staff, and provide ongoing support. Unlike traditional RN positions, these jobs blend clinical knowledge with sales skills, often requiring travel to different healthcare settings. Compensation is typically hourly, with potential bonuses or commissions based on sales performance.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an hourly RN medical device sales professional?

To excel as an Hourly RN Medical Device Sales professional, you need a valid RN license, strong clinical knowledge, and a solid understanding of medical devices and their applications. Familiarity with CRM systems, sales tracking tools, and often certifications in specific medical device technologies are commonly required. Excellent communication, relationship-building, and problem-solving skills help you connect with healthcare providers and address customer needs effectively. These abilities ensure you can bridge the gap between clinical expertise and sales, driving product adoption and customer satisfaction.

What are some common challenges faced by hourly RN medical device sales professionals, and how can they be addressed?

Hourly RN Medical Device Sales professionals often face the challenge of balancing clinical responsibilities with sales targets, especially when working with multiple healthcare facilities or clients. Time management and adaptability are key, as the role requires rapid learning of new device features and tailoring demonstrations to diverse clinical teams. Building trust with healthcare providers is essential, and success often comes from leveraging clinical expertise to communicate the value of products effectively. Strong organizational skills and proactive communication with both the sales team and clinical staff can help overcome these challenges.

We're looking for Medical Surgical RNs for an immediate travel nurse opening in Oconomowoc, WI. The right RN should have 1-2 years recent acute care experience. Read below for more requirements. 
As a MedSurg RN, you will conduct patient assessments and prioritize data collection based on patients' immediate conditions or needs. MedSurg RNs perform ongoing assessments and appropriate treatments as ordered by a physician. Documenting patient findings and providing education and support to patients' families is essential to this travel nurse position. 
As a Medical Surgical Travel Nurse, you should be prepared to perform the following tasks:

  • Provide bedside care for a variety of patients, including pre- and post-op patients.
  • Prepare, administer and record prescribed medication, reporting any adverse reactions to treatment.
  • Change dressings, insert catheters and start IVs.
  • Prepares equipment and aids physician during examination and treatment of patient.
  • Educates patients on surgical procedures.
  • Participates in discharge planning and initiates patient education plan as prescribed by physician.

Medical Surgical Travel Nurses should be able to stand and walk for long periods of time, as well as bend, lean and stoop without difficulty. RNs should be able to easily lift 20 pounds. Moving or lifting of patients may require lifting of up to 50 pounds at times. RNs will work in a fast-paced environment treating patients that may be confused, agitated, and/or uncooperative.

About Travel Nurse Across America

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

Travel Nurse Across America (TNAA) is a leading healthcare staffing firm headquartered in North Little Rock, Arkansas, USA. Their primary focus lies within the healthcare industry, specializing in providing travel nurses for medical facilities across the country. Founded in 1999, TNAA has thrived over the years by maintaining an unwavering dedication to quality service, reliability, and personalized care for both the clients and the teams they contract. Their mission is driven by their commitment to improve the lives of the patients they serve by ensuring they're provided with the most highly skilled, caring, and dedicated healthcare professionals.
